Our BSc (Hons) Economics program equips you with valuable skills demanded in today's complex economic landscape, where both private and public institutions face growing challenges. Our curriculum stays ahead of industry trends, incorporating practical knowledge from the field. Every faculty member in our School of Economics actively contributes to research, with several serving as consultants to globally recognized institutions. The program's acclaimed Professional Training opportunities effectively bridge classroom learning with real-world industry demands. Through this economics degree, you'll explore how individuals, businesses, and governments - the fundamental components of society - make economic choices. The curriculum delves into both independent economic behaviors and their interconnected relationships, examining domestic and global interactions. Students gain specialized expertise while investigating pressing issues facing contemporary economies.

All enrolled students receive comprehensive career support during their studies, with alumni maintaining access to these resources for three years post-graduation. Economic choices form the foundation of societal development, influencing outcomes for people, businesses, and nations alike. This diversity translates into numerous career possibilities for economics graduates, along with a versatile skill set. Employers particularly value our program's emphasis on practical problem-solving, industry-relevant coursework, and the professional experience gained through training placements.

Qualification Requirements

A-level
Overall
BSc (Hons):
AAB
Applicants taking an A-level science subject with the Science Practical Endorsement are required to pass the practical element.

Please note: A-level General Studies and A-level Critical Thinking are not accepted.

BSc (Hons) with foundation year:
CCC
Applicants taking an A-level science subject with the Science Practical Endorsement are required to pass the practical element.

Please note: A-level General Studies and A-level Critical Thinking are not accepted.

GCSE or equivalent: GCSE English Language at Grade C (4). Additionally, GCSE Mathematics at Grade A (7) (or equivalent) is usually required but applicants with GCSE Maths at Grade B (6) and GCSE Physics or Chemistry at grade A (7) are also encouraged to apply.

Applicants with GCSE Maths B (6) and a Level 3 Core Maths qualification at grade B or A-level Economics A-level grade B (achieved or predicted) will also be considered. Applicants for the foundation year will be considered with Maths at Grade B (6). Applicants must have achieved the required GCSE grades at the time of making their application.
